You must set the Minecraft Version!

Статус
В этой теме нельзя размещать новые ответы.
Версия Minecraft
1.7.10

GoogleTan

Картошка :3
1,354
43
310
Intellij idea странно ругается на версию мц:

'C:\forge-1.7.10-10.13.4.1614-1.7.10-src\build.gradle' line: 19 A problem occurred evaluating root project 'forge-1.7.10-10.13.4.1614-1.7.10-src'. > Failed to apply plugin [id 'forge'] > You must set the Minecraft Version! > java.lang.NullPointerException (no error message)
Build file




build.gradle:
Java:
buildscript {
    repositories {
        mavenCentral()
        maven {
            name = "forge"
            url = "http://files.minecraftforge.net/maven"
        }
        maven {
            name = "sonatype"
            url = "https://oss.sonatype.org/content/repositories/snapshots/"
        }
    }
    dependencies {
        classpath 'net.minecraftforge.gradle:ForgeGradle:1.2-SNAPSHOT'
    }
}


apply plugin: "forge"
version = "1.0"
group= "ru.googletan.keypass"
archivesBaseName = "keypass"

minecraft {
    version = "1.7.10-10.13.4.1614-1.7.10"
   // runDir = "eclipse"
}

dependencies {
    // you may put jars on which you depend on in ./libs
    // or you may define them like so..
    //compile "some.group:artifact:version:classifier"
    //compile "some.group:artifact:version"
  
    // real examples
    //compile 'com.mod-buildcraft:buildcraft:6.0.8:dev'  // adds buildcraft to the dev env
    //compile 'com.googlecode.efficient-java-matrix-library:ejml:0.24' // adds ejml to the dev env

    // for more info...
    // http://www.gradle.org/docs/current/userguide/artifact_dependencies_tutorial.html
    // http://www.gradle.org/docs/current/userguide/dependency_management.html

}

processResources
{
    // this will ensure that this task is redone when the versions change.
    inputs.property "version", project.version
    inputs.property "mcversion", project.minecraft.version

    // replace stuff in mcmod.info, nothing else
    from(sourceSets.main.resources.srcDirs) {
        include 'mcmod.info'
            
        // replace version and mcversion
        expand 'version':project.version, 'mcversion':project.minecraft.version
    }
    
    // copy everything else, thats not the mcmod.info
    from(sourceSets.main.resources.srcDirs) {
        exclude 'mcmod.info'
    }
}
 
Последнее редактирование:
Решение
и правда нет, ну тогда вот так
610e311374.jpg



затем как загрузится жмешь
58ec58403a.jpg


он покажет окно, в котором выберешь 1.8 (она конечно уже должна стоять, ну или 7ку)
9608d1396d.jpg

я выбрал jre, но он почему то всё равно её схавал и заработал

Он перезапустит IntelliJ, на это не обращай внимание (хотя можешь и нажать, это не принципиально я думаю)
8aefb0cc0b.jpg


Ну и наконец переходим на вкладку Gradle, в которой теперь всё пучком...
1,038
57
229
какую версию поставил?
 
1,038
57
229
ой, простите. У тя просто двойня на аватарке, конечно А.
я прям хз уже что эт, на вирусню тоже не похоже..
 
1,038
57
229

GoogleTan

Картошка :3
1,354
43
310
1,038
57
229
d40e1ae9f8.jpg

Каждый gradle поддерживает определенную версию JDK, поэтому тебе надо скачать именно ту, которая поддерживает твою JDK, либо выбрать для gradle поддерживаемую им JDK
1c82344b59.jpg



Типо инструкция по обновлению, только тебе надо другую версию указать

Upgrade Instructions
Switch your build to use Gradle 5.4.1 by updating your wrapper properties:

./gradlew wrapper --gradle-version=5.4.1



про твою 2.8:
Gradle requires a Java JDK or JRE to be installed, version 6 or higher (to check, use java -version). Gradle ships with its own Groovy library, therefore Groovy does not need to be installed. Any existing Groovy installation is ignored by Gradle.
Gradle uses whatever JDK it finds in your path. Alternatively, you can set the JAVA_HOME environment variable to point to the installation directory of the desired JDK.

вот только на сколько higher к сожалению не указано... И видимо 10ка (JDK) в их количество не входит
 
Последнее редактирование:
1,038
57
229
и правда нет, ну тогда вот так
610e311374.jpg



затем как загрузится жмешь
58ec58403a.jpg


он покажет окно, в котором выберешь 1.8 (она конечно уже должна стоять, ну или 7ку)
9608d1396d.jpg

я выбрал jre, но он почему то всё равно её схавал и заработал

Он перезапустит IntelliJ, на это не обращай внимание (хотя можешь и нажать, это не принципиально я думаю)
8aefb0cc0b.jpg


Ну и наконец переходим на вкладку Gradle, в которой теперь всё пучком
c72cd13776.jpg
 
Статус
В этой теме нельзя размещать новые ответы.
Сверху